When Did the Tour de France Start?

The Tour de France is the oldest and most well-known of the bicycle grand tours, which also includes the Giro d’Italia and Vuelta a Espana. In essence, they are the Italian and the Spanish versions of the Tour de France.

The race was started in 1903 as a pitch to increase sales for the newspaper L’Auto and has been held every year since, except from 1915 to 1918 and 1940 to 1946 due to the World Wars.

Today, the race attracts thousands of viewers in person, and in 2024, the viewing of the event globally was one hundred and fifty million people.

The Route: Where Will The Cyclists Go?

According to the official website, www.letour.fr/en/, there are 21 stages to the race, which are broken down into the early, the middle, and the final stages. This year, eight towns were added to the race, including Lauwin-Planque and Vif.

Grand Départ and Early Stages:

  • Stage One (July 5): The race will begin in Lille, located in the Hauts-de-France region, with a 185 km loop starting and finishing in the city center. ​
  • Stages Two to Four (July 6-8): The route will move westward, passing through Normandy and Brittany, with specific details about these stages yet to be fully disclosed. ​

Mid-Race Highlights:

  • Stage Five (July 9): An individual time trial covering 33 km around Caen. ​
  • Stage 10 (July 14): The first major mountain stage, featuring ascents in the Massif Central, including the Col de la Loze, the highest point of the 2025 Tour at 2,304 meters. ​
  • Stage 13 (July 18): A mountain time trial of 11 km to the Peyragudes Altiport.

Final Stages:

  • Stage 16 (July 22): A 172 km stage from Montpellier to Mont Ventoux, marking the return of this iconic climb to the Tour route. ​
  • Stage 18 (July 24): A challenging stage from Vif to Courchevel, culminating with the ascent of the Col de la Loze.
  • Stage 21 (July 27): The race will conclude with a traditional finish on the Champs-Élysées in Paris. ​
